2026 Subaru Impreza - Maintenance & Specs
The 2026 Subaru Impreza belongs to a Subaru Impreza lineup that Know Your Ride tracks across 17 model years, from 1993 to 2026. Engine options on record include the 2.0L, 2.5L. It is configured as all-wheel drive with an automatic (av-s8). This 2026 car is the most recent Subaru Impreza model year on record.
It takes 0W-20 full synthetic oil, 5.1 qt with a new filter. Fluid specs on file include Super Long Life coolant, DOT 3 brake fluid, Subaru ATF HP transmission fluid. Know Your Ride lists 20 scheduled maintenance items for this vehicle, the earliest interval falling at 5,000 miles. Documented torque values include oil drain plug 33 ft-lb, lug nut 89 ft-lb, spark plug 18 ft-lb.
Its overall reliability signal is rated "Excellent" based on aggregated complaint and crash data.
EPA fuel economy is rated at 27 city / 33 highway MPG, 29 MPG combined. Estimated annual fuel cost is about $1,500.
Quick Specs
| Oil viscosity | 0W-20 |
| Oil type | Full Synthetic |
| Oil capacity (w/ filter) | 5.1 qt |
| Oil filter | Subaru 15208AA170 |
| EPA combined | 29 MPG |
| Tire size | 215/55R17 |
| Coolant | Super Long Life |
| Technical service bulletins | 13 |
